Does the issue really lie on traffic itself or within us? According to Reverso online dictionary, traffic jam is a number of vehicles so obstructed that they can scarcely move. Traffic has been a very big issue in our society today. Many residents spend hours stuck in traffic. Many people have problems because of this. For example students cannot take the exam because they arrive late in school and workers gets penalty in their salary because theyre late for work or business professionals cannot attend their meetings because of heavy traffic. Problems like these need to be addressed immediately. Listed are several causes and effects of traffic as categorized by: (1) caused by the road managers; and; (2) caused by the road users. Let’s start with the ones brought about by the road managers: (1) poor route planning – the private and public vehicles are not evenly distributed on one road; (2) poor parking spaces – using the left or right lane of the road as a parking space causes congestion; (3) unnecessary road works – causes inefficient route planning; and; (4) lack of enforcement of traffic rules and regulations – this gives drivers and commuters the feeling that they are not bound by traffic rules. Next, we have the ones caused by the road users: (1) undisciplined drivers and commuters – this causes accidents; (2) lack of time management – this causes people to be late; (3) increasing number of population thus increasing car users – more car users result to congestion and discourage potential investors from bringing in more business in the Queen City of the South. Here are our proposed solutions for reducing traffic: • Better route planning • Proper parking spaces • Road works, if necessary, should be done at night. In that way, more work can be done in less time. • Traffic rules and regulations should be enforced as to make drivers and commuters feel that they are bound to rules and regulations • Time management reduces aggressiveness in commuters and drivers. • Imposing car coding or carless days With these cause and effects that have been mentioned, we can say that it is not only the system that has a role to play in managing traffic but also the road users. Although increasing capacity, as what road works would provide, only addresses the issue of congestion, which is short term. We also need to impose order as to address the behavioral factor of it because ‘Imposing order‘ actually means ‘imposing discipline‘ which have long term results.
